Questions & Answers

Q: How did Ryan Murphy approach the transformation of the mid-century house?

Ryan Murphy decided to blend designs from different time periods to create a tribute to the best of design from the past 500 years. He wanted to challenge traditional mid-century styles and incorporate contemporary art and furniture pieces.

Q: What were some unique furniture pieces included in the house?

The house features a monolithic gray Alabaster dining table created by Rick Owens and Michelle Lame. Unusual combinations, such as a Rick Owen stainless aluminum table placed near a Jeff Koons gazing ball masterpiece, showcase boundary-pushing art and design.

Q: How were the interiors of the house revamped?

The interiors were transformed with a shift from tobacco tones to cool grays and shimmering silvers. The Walnut paneling contrasted with cooler tones, creating a Roman apartment-like atmosphere. The bathroom areas were dramatized with black mosaic tiles, enhancing the luxurious feel.

Q: How did the gardens of the house complement the design theme?

The gardens were designed by Scott Schrager to evoke a classical and Roman aesthetic. The goal was to soften the parameters of the house and create a unified, monochromatic tone. A 1650 N Fountain became the centerpiece, surrounded by concrete benches, replacing a fake lawn with creamy gravel.
